Wilmar International
Wilmar International
 This is an update to our post dated 10 Jan 2011, where we
concluded “The path of least resistance is for prices to
correct for 1-4 bars and continue its descend until further
price action suggests otherwise”
 Since our last commentary, prices closed that following
week higher, then descended to close this week just above
the 38.2% Fibo Retracement level
 Watch for the Chikou Span as it flirts with the lower band of
Kumo
 We maintain our view that prices would continue its descend
until further price action suggests otherwise

Bank Rakyat Indonesia
Bank Rakyat Indonesia
 Prices corrected after the weak bearish Tenkan
Sen/Kijun Sen crossover
 Found support at the Kumo and rebounded sharply
as of last week’s close
 Chikou Span now above prices
 We expect prices to stay sideways in the short term
and strategically bullish in the longer term with
strong support provided by the Kumo
Toshiba Corp
Toshiba Corp
 Prices broke upside of the Kumo following a weak
bullish Tenkan Sen/Kijun Sen crossover
 Concurrently, both prices and Chikou Span broke
above Kumo
 Also, we had a future Kumo twist
 Next possible resistance provided by the Kumo
shadow shown as white horizontal line
 We think it is a good time to start accumulating
longs with stop loss at the Kijun Sen
AU Optronics Corp
AU Optronics Corp
 Current Ichimoku tells a bearish story
 Price below Kumo, Tenkan Sen below Kijun Sen
since the strong bearish crossover,
 Chikou Span is below prices
 Kumo is thickening into the future, providing
strong resistance
 We expect prices to continue its downtrend
GBPUSD
GBPUSD
 We had a strong bullish Tenkan Sen/Kijun Sen
crossover 1 month ago
 Chikou Span had broken upside of the Kumo
 Senkou Span A is above Senkou Span B and the
Kumo is thickening
 Tenkan Sen, Kijun Sen, Senkou Span A and Senkou
Span B are all sloping upwards
 We think it is a good time to accumulate the Sterling
against the Dollar with stop loss at the Kijun Sen
